Longtime favorite go-to protein
Deli meats have long been a staple in households and foodservice menus worldwide. Their convenience, versatility, and rich flavorsmake them a go-to option for everything from sandwiches and salads to charcuterie boards and high protein meal solutions. While traditionally valued for their taste and ease of preparation, deli meats are now being reimagined to align with evolving consumer preferences - particularly the growing demand for high-protein, better-for-you options.
Modern takes on deli meats
Today, deli meats are no longer confined to their classic forms. Food manufacturers and processors are innovating with new formats, ingredients, and nutritional enhancements to meet consumer expectations. From high-protein, low-fat turkey and chicken breast options to premium, clean label charcuterie cuts, the market is experiencing a shift toward healthier, more functional meats. Additionally, hybrid and plant-based deli solutions are emerging, catering to flexitarian consumers who seek both protein and sustainability in their diets.
What are high-protein deli meats and why do they matter?
High-protein deli meats are specifically formulated to provide enhanced protein delivery. These meats support modern dietary trends, appealing to athletes, fitness enthusiasts, and health-conscious consumers looking for satisfying, protein-rich foods.
Their relevance is greater than ever, as protein continues to be a top nutritional priority. Consumers seek out protein not just for muscle support but also for satiety, weight management, and overall well-being. Meanwhile, the demand for clean label, minimally processed, and functional foods means that deli meats fortified with high-quality proteins are an attractive option for both retail and foodservice markets.

High/source of protein claims are prevalent:
Deli meat launches claiming high/source of protein recorded a CAGR of +9.1% during Apr 2021-Mar 2024. In line with this, high/ source of protein is a growing positioning in Europe and MEA in Oct 22-Mar 24, with the inclusion of protein ingredients like soy, milk, pork protein, and pork/beef collagen likely to support further growth in NPD.
Innova Market Insights – Overview of Deli Meat – Global – Jul 2024.
